Books are the great resource to learn Forex Trading. You can find a huge collection of books written on different aspects of Forex trading in the internet or in your local book store. Some of the books are written for the very beginner who don't know anything about Forex Trading, and some has been written for the intermediate and advanced traders to sharpen their knowledge to trade the currency market.

Below you will find 3 books on Forex Trading Basics. The 2nd one is "Forex for Beginners" by Anna Coulling. And the 3rd one is "Forex Trading: The Basics Explained in Simple Terms" by Jim Brown. These are the books that are highly popular by the readers. All these three books has been written by their own unique ways to explain the basics of currency trading market. If you don't know anything about the currency trading or Forex trading market, then you can choose any of the one book from this list to learn all the necessary details of Forex trading and get started to trade in the world's largest liquidity market to make a better living.

Paperback Kindle. The book explained all the necessary details to learn the Forex market. Which includes how the Forex market works, what moves it and how to detect and predict its next move to make profit.

It also further explained about the Pro's and Con's of currency trading, risk management models, interpreting economic data, differentiating different types of currency pairs like Majors Minors and Exotics, reading the market sentiment and traders psychology to make better trading decision and trade the currency market successfully, and many more.

This book " Forex For Beginners - What you need to know to get started and everything in between " by Anna Coulling is a great resource for not only a beginner in Forex, but also an intermediate level trader can get benefit from this book. This book did not explained every single term of Forex trading, rather it just pointed out the major topics that is necessary for a beginner trader to learn about Forex trading. This book has been written in a very practical approach that any kind of trader can turn themselves into the next level and make successful trade entries.

Other than the basic concepts of Forex, this book also explained some more important things like Volume Price Analysis, Trading Mechanics, guide to make a trading plan, trading psychology, choosing right broker, selecting the right currency pairs, and some other very practical contexts to enrich a beginners mind with good Forex Trading knowledge.
